Israeli-designated 'safe zones' in Gaza furthering genocide: Rights group report

The Palestinian human rights non-profit organisation Al-Haq has published a new report pointing out how "evacuation orders" and alleged "safe zones" determined by Israel are only furthering the act of genocide across Gaza.

Entitled How to "Hide a Genocide: The Role of Evacuation Orders and Safe Zones in Israel's Genocidal Campaign in Gaza," Al-Haq pointed to "mass atrocities... taking place amidst regular evacuation orders instructing the entire population of the North to move south immediately so [Israel] can resettle the area."

"Since the very first week of its genocide, Israel has methodically cleared vast stretches of the Gaza Strip of its inhabitants through its unlawful issuance of evacuation orders. These are presented to the public as proof of its efforts to minimise civilian casualties and to support its alleged compliance with fundamental principles of international humanitarian law (IHL)," the report said.

"However, they achieve the direct opposite," it added. 

"Despite being unilaterally established by Israel, the Israeli military routinely targets both the [safe] zones themselves as well as the routes it has instructed forcibly displaced Palestinians to use as they flee in search of ever-evasive safety. Crowded together with no place of refuge, Palestinians are either killed by Israeli strikes, severely physically and mentally injured by the IOF’s physical and psychological warfare, or subjected to a slow death from the environment of total deprivation into which they have been plunged."
